Apple Extended Keyboard 2 - ¿La tecla de bloqueo de mayúsculas no funciona en macOS High Sierra?

Tengo un Apple Extended Keyboard 2, que ya tiene casi 28 años, pero aún funciona muy bien. Para usar este viejo teclado, uso un adaptador USB ADB de Belkin.

Tengo una MacBook Pro 2014 y una PC. En la PC, el teclado funciona muy bien. Mi MacBook Pro tiene dos particiones, una con OS X Mavericks 10.9.5 y otra con macOS High Sierra 10.13.4 instalado. El teclado funciona muy bien en OS X Mavericks, pero no en macOS High sierra.

Todo excepto la tecla de bloqueo de mayúsculas funciona. Al hacer clic (o mantener presionada) la tecla de bloqueo de mayúsculas, no sucede nada. La luz de bloqueo de mayúsculas no se ilumina y la Mac no escribe letras mayúsculas. Tenga en cuenta que la tecla de bloqueo de mayúsculas funciona tanto en OS X Mavericks como en PC. Dado que el teclado y el adaptador funcionan en otro lugar, deduzco que funcionan a la perfección.

El bloqueo de mayúsculas funciona en otros teclados y no se necesitó instalación ni para OS X Mavericks ni para la PC para que el teclado funcione. La PC está ejecutando Windows 10.

Esto es lo que he intentado que falló:

  • Restablecer las teclas modificadoras a los System preferences → Keyboardvalores predeterminados y lo mismo que en la otra Mac.

  • Vuelva a ejecutar el Asistente de configuración del teclado varias veces.

  • Mover la plist ubicada en /Library/Preferences/com.apple.keyboardtype.plista macOS High Sierra desde OS X Mavericks. (Revertido tras intento fallido).

¿Cómo puedo hacer que la tecla de bloqueo de mayúsculas funcione en el teclado antiguo en macOS High Sierra?

¿Funciona en modo seguro?
Vea esta respuesta sobre cómo ver si macOS está recibiendo los códigos de escaneo del teclado: apple.stackexchange.com/a/317556/119271
Para @Allan: Mayúsculas no funciona en modo seguro. La tecla de bloqueo de mayúsculas no aparece en la terminal cuando se escanea el teclado. Aparecen otras claves.
¿Utilizó la xevutilidad (con XQuartz) que mencioné? También puede utilizar el visor de eventos de Karabiner.
¿Ha intentado configurar una nueva cuenta de usuario y ver si el teclado funciona allí mismo?
¿Otros teclados tienen el bloqueo de mayúsculas funcionando correctamente con su High Sierra?
Para @Allan: Usé la utilidad xev. Al probar con la vista de eventos de Karabiner, muestra el evento Caps.
Para @TomGewecke El teclado no funciona correctamente en otras cuentas, pero el bloqueo de mayúsculas de otros teclados sí funciona, tanto integrado como externo una vez.
¿Ha intentado activar/desactivar Teclado> Modificadores> Bloq Mayús/Sin acción? apple.stackexchange.com/a/199253/15281
Si lo anterior lo resuelve, la solución permanente, una aplicación personalizada, está aquí: apple.stackexchange.com/a/199958/15281
Para @MattSephton: Gracias por la sugerencia, pero no funcionó.
De hecho, tengo uno de esos teclados y un adaptador ADB, así que intentaré configurarlos durante el fin de semana.

Respuestas (1)

Encontré una solución:

Vaya a Preferencias del sistema > Accesibilidad

Cuando la ventana de accesibilidad esté abierta, en la parte izquierda de la ventana, haga clic en Teclado

Luego estarán las 2 opciones: para teclas adhesivas y para teclas lentas: haga clic en el cuadro junto a las teclas lentas para habilitarlo, luego haga clic en el botón Opciones... - Aparecerá una nueva ventana con un control deslizante para cambiar la aceptación. retraso: por defecto, esto está en el medio. Deslice el botón completamente hacia la izquierda, para que sea el menor tiempo posible.

Proviene de Cómo eliminar el retraso del bloqueo de mayúsculas en el teclado de aluminio Apple MacBook Pro cuando se inicia en Linux , que también puede explicar por qué no funcionó desde el principio.

Gracias a @MattSephton que proporcionó el enlace en un comentario.

¡Trabajó para mi! ¡MUCHAS GRACIAS! (escrito usando una tecla física de bloqueo de mayúsculas presionada en un hermoso Apple Extended Keyboard II, conectado a un adaptador Griffin ADB-USB).